Abstract
PURPOSE:To minimize the size of an extra length process part and to increase processing efficiency, by rolling both an extra length and a part of connection of an optical fiber on the same sheet. CONSTITUTION:The connecting parts 2 of several optical fiber core wires are fixed en bloc onto a sheet of extra length process sheet 5. An extra length 3 at the side of an optical cable 8 is put on the sheet 5 through a core wire guide 6 of a cylindrical bobbin 4. Then the sheet 5 is wound around the bobbin 4. In such way, the size of an extra length process part is minimized to increase the processing efficiency.
